However, Walsh's journey began humbly with a different series. In January 2014, at the age of twenty-four, she started writing about a cocky, self-assured man named Kyle Carter. She wrote feverishly, completing the manuscript in just five weeks. Her debut novel, Break My Fall , was self-published on Valentineβs Day 2014. Initially, it was only meant for a handful of friends who had come over for tea and were curious to read her work on their e-readers.

by Chloe Walsh is a foundational contemporary romance novel originally published in 2014. It serves as the dramatic first installment of the author's bestselling Broken Series . Long before the author achieved global TikTok fame with her Boys of Tommen books, this novel established her signature style of blending high-stakes emotional trauma, dark secrets, and intense, captivating love stories.
